Switzerland wanted to know the status of its cybersecurity capacity: its strengths and weaknesses.  At the invite of the Foreign Department of Foreign Affairs (FDFA) and Foreign Department of Finance (FDF), the GCSCC conducted a CMM review in June 2020. Switzerland plans to use the results of the study for the evaluation of the Confederations cybersecurity structures.

The conclusions of the study can then be incorporated into the evaluation of the Confederation's cybersecurity structures, which were created within the framework of the National strategy for the protection of Switzerland against cyber risks (NCS) for the period 2018–22. Conducting and publishing the study will also send out a strong signal beyond Swiss borders. "The study emphasises Switzerland's willingness to engage in fact-based discussion with other states. This transparency builds trust and strengthens cooperation, and our approach also encourages other states to undergo their own evaluations.
